About the role

The Servicing Operations Analyst plays a crucial role in ensuring the smooth and efficient operations of servicing activities within Point’s Servicing Team. This position involves analyzing and monitoring servicing processes, building actionable dashboards, creating and tracking performance metrics, and implementing strategies to optimize workflows. The role requires strong data analysis skills, deep knowledge of mortgage servicing and home equity investments, and the ability to partner with subservicers and internal stakeholders to drive measurable improvements.

 

Your responsibilities

  • Create, track, and monitor KPIs and SLAs for both Point’s internal servicing teams and external subservicers, ensuring performance aligns with strategic and regulatory expectations.
  • Drive initiatives with subservicers and key vendors to improve operations and the Homeowner experience.
  • Collect, analyze, and interpret servicing data from Subservicers and internal Point data to identify trends, gaps, and risks across processes, staffing, and performance.
  • Identify risks in the portfolio by monitoring mortgage delinquency, disaster events, and event of default activity, ensuring timely resolution and accountability across team tasks.
  • Translate insights into actionable recommendations and partner with internal teams and subservicers to implement improvements.
  • Forecast staffing models and operational needs using data-driven methodologies.
  • Develop and present reports to leadership and cross-functional teams, providing data-backed recommendations to improve efficiency and outcomes.
  • Participate in process improvement initiatives, including SOP creation and updates, ensuring consistency and scalability across servicing functions.
  • Collaborate across teams to ensure high-quality execution of initiatives, driving measurable performance improvements.
  • Partner with Product, Engineering, and Data teams to improve servicing processes, enhance data models, and ensure data accuracy and integrity across systems.
  • Build, maintain, and optimize dashboards within Sigma to monitor servicing performance, identify trends, and present insights to stakeholders.

 

About you

  • Bachelor’s degree in Business Administration, Finance, Data Analytics, or a related field (or equivalent experience).
  • In-depth knowledge of mortgage servicing and/or servicing home equity investments.
  • Proven experience working with subservicers (RoundPoint, BSI preferred) and internal servicing operations.
  • Strong proficiency in Sigma (dashboard creation, reporting, and analysis) and other data analysis tools.
  • Demonstrated ability to create and manage KPIs and SLAs, analyze trends, forecast operational needs, and proactively address performance or staffing gaps.
  • Experience identifying portfolio risks through mortgage delinquency monitoring, disaster event tracking, and event of default oversight.
  • Excellent analytical skills with the ability to create actionable insights and influence decision-making.
  • Effective at presenting data-driven findings to stakeholders and driving organizational change.
  • Knowledge of regulatory requirements and compliance in mortgage servicing.
  • Strong problem-solving and decision-making abilities with keen attention to detail.
  • Ability to manage multiple priorities in a fast-paced environment and work independently when needed.
  • Familiarity with mortgage servicing systems and software is a plus.

Compensation at Point will be determined by skills, experience, and geographic location. Point has identified the expected annual base salary for this role at this level based on the market by tiers (Region | Location | Market Salary):

  • Tier 1 | San Francisco Bay Area, New York, and Seattle | $72,200 - $79,500
  • Tier 2 | Chicago, Austin, Denver, Boston, Washington DC, San Diego, Portland, Sacramento, Philadelphia, Los Angeles & Santa Barbara | $64,600 - $72,000
  • Tier 3 | All other US metro areas | $58,000 - $63,800

This does not include any other potential components of the compensation package, including equity, benefits, and perks outlined above. At the launch of each position, we benchmark compensation to the appropriate role and level utilizing competitive compensation data from various data sources as references. At the offer stage, we use the signal we received from our interviews, coupled with your experience, location, and other job-related factors, to determine final compensation.
